Recovery data has become a measurable factor that bettors incorporate into accumulator construction across soccer, tennis, basketball and horse racing, with analysts tracking variables such as days between matches, travel distance and physiological markers to adjust selections. Observers note that patterns emerge when these metrics align across disciplines, allowing for structured combinations that reflect documented performance trends rather than isolated outcomes.

Recovery metrics in soccer and their carryover effects

European leagues publish fixture congestion reports that detail average rest intervals for clubs, and data from the 2025-26 season shows teams with fewer than three days between matches record lower expected goal differentials in subsequent fixtures. Analysts combine these figures with player-level GPS data on high-intensity runs completed in prior games, creating filters that highlight squads likely to underperform when added to multis. One study released by the Australian Institute of Sport examined 420 matches and found a 12 percent drop in sprint volume after short recovery windows, figures that now feed into models used by professional syndicates.

Tennis recovery windows and surface transitions

ATP and WTA schedules list exact turnaround times between tournaments, while wearable data from devices such as Whoop and Oura reveal sleep quality and heart-rate variability trends that correlate with win percentages on specific surfaces. Researchers tracking 2026 hard-court swing results documented that players crossing time zones with under 48 hours recovery win 8 percent fewer matches than those with extended rest, information that sharpens accumulator legs when paired with soccer or basketball selections. Observers note that serve-percentage declines appear most pronounced after consecutive three-set matches, providing a quantifiable edge for totals markets.

Basketball load management and back-to-back indicators

NBA teams release official rest-day reports before each slate, and tracking services log cumulative minutes played over the preceding seven days. Data compiled by the National Basketball Association shows teams on the second night of a back-to-back post 4.2 fewer points per 100 possessions on average, a statistic that analysts cross-reference with horse-racing form when building cross-sport accumulators. In August 2026, the league's expanded in-season tournament schedule increased back-to-back frequency for several Eastern Conference clubs, producing measurable dips in defensive efficiency that betting syndicates incorporated into multi-leg constructions.

Horse racing layoffs and return patterns

Racing authorities in Australia and Ireland publish official layoff statistics that detail winning percentages for horses returning after 30-, 60- and 90-day breaks. Figures from Racing Australia indicate that animals resuming after 45 to 60 days achieve strike rates 6 percent above their career averages when trained by yards with documented short-term recovery protocols. These percentages integrate with team-rest data from other sports because they supply an independent performance variable that does not overlap with fixture-congestion models, allowing accumulators to diversify risk across unrelated fatigue cycles.

Combining datasets for accumulator construction

Professional syndicates merge soccer rest-day flags, tennis travel logs, basketball back-to-back indicators and racing layoff statistics into unified spreadsheets that score each leg according to historical hit rates. A 2025 report issued by Sportradar documented that multis containing three or more legs filtered through multi-sport recovery thresholds produced a 3.8 percent improvement in long-term yield compared with unfiltered selections. Analysts apply these thresholds sequentially, first eliminating congested soccer sides, then adding rested tennis players, and finally confirming basketball or racing legs that meet independent recovery criteria before finalizing the slip.
